Christina Monterroso
Now retired after serving with Latin American Mission in San Jose, Costa Rica
Christina Monterroso, a native Costa Ricans with 4 children and 2 grandchildren, is now retired from active ministry in Costa Rica. Her husband Victor, who passed away in 2008, was the pastor of the Templo Biblico in the capital of San Jose, as well as serving with Latin America Mission by training and supporting pastors across Central America. Both Victor and Christina were also actively involved in Radio outreach.
Over the past 20 years, there has been a close relationship between the Monterrosos and Village Green. Victor and Christina came to London several times for 1-month periods to live and serve among us. A number of people from Village Green have also visited the Monterrosos in Costa Rica to observe and assist their work with Latin America Mission and the Templo Biblico.
